Upset wins to Lamb
Riccarton's Graham Lamb pulled off the biggest upset in this season's Agrade inter-club table-tennis competition by beating all three members of the powerful Avonside No. 1 team. Lamb, a former Canterbury representative, played consistently to inflict the first defeat of the season on Maurice Burrowes, and then went on to beat Jan Morris and Michael Burrows. Lamb’s effort was not enough however as Avonside went on to win the match 7-5. John Armstrong continued on his winning way and assisted Riccarton No. 2 to a 7-5 win over Avonside No. 3. However, Karl Entwistle, fresh from a successful tour of New South Wales with the New Zealand under-15 side, and Bert
Thompson made him work hard for his victories. Points after four rounds: Avonside I 4, Riccarton I and Riccarton II 3, Avonside II and Linwood 2, Avonside 111 and Dallington 1, Riccarton 111 0.
